AI Driven Predictive Analytics for IT Project Timelines
Enhance IT project management with our AI-driven predictive analytics workflow for accurate timeline forecasting and efficient resource optimization.
Category: AI in Project Management
Industry: Information Technology
Introduction
This predictive analytics workflow outlines a structured approach to forecasting timelines in IT projects, utilizing advanced AI-driven tools and methodologies. By integrating data collection, model development, risk assessment, resource optimization, and continuous monitoring, this workflow aims to enhance the accuracy and efficiency of project management processes.
Data Collection and Preparation
- Historical Data Gathering: Collect data from past IT projects, including timelines, resource allocation, task durations, and project outcomes.
- Data Cleaning and Preprocessing: Utilize AI-driven tools such as DataRobot to automatically clean and prepare data for analysis.
- Feature Engineering: Apply machine learning algorithms to identify relevant features that influence project timelines.
Model Development and Training
- Algorithm Selection: Select appropriate machine learning algorithms for timeline prediction, such as regression models, decision trees, or neural networks.
- Model Training: Train the chosen models using historical project data.
- Cross-Validation: Implement k-fold cross-validation to ensure model robustness and mitigate overfitting.
Timeline Forecasting
- Input Current Project Data: Enter the details of the new IT project into the predictive model.
- Generate Initial Forecast: The model generates an initial timeline prediction based on historical patterns.
- Confidence Intervals: Calculate confidence intervals to provide a range of possible completion dates.
AI-Enhanced Risk Assessment
- Risk Identification: Utilize natural language processing (NLP) tools like IBM Watson to analyze project documentation and identify potential risks.
- Risk Quantification: Apply machine learning algorithms to assess the probability and impact of identified risks on the project timeline.
- Timeline Adjustment: Automatically adjust the forecasted timeline based on identified risks.
Resource Optimization
- Skill Matching: Use AI-powered tools like Forecast to align team members’ skills with project requirements.
- Workload Balancing: Optimize resource allocation to prevent bottlenecks and ensure efficient timeline progression.
- Scenario Analysis: Generate multiple resource allocation scenarios and assess their impact on the project timeline.
Continuous Monitoring and Adaptation
- Real-Time Progress Tracking: Implement AI-driven project management platforms like Celoxis to monitor project progress in real-time.
- Automated Alerts: Establish AI-powered alerts for deviations from the forecasted timeline.
- Dynamic Reforecasting: Continuously update the timeline forecast as new data becomes available during project execution.
Stakeholder Communication
- Automated Reporting: Utilize AI to generate customized reports for various stakeholders, highlighting key timeline metrics and potential issues.
- Natural Language Generation: Employ NLG tools to create human-readable summaries of complex timeline data.
Performance Analysis and Improvement
- Post-Project Analysis: After project completion, analyze the accuracy of timeline predictions and identify areas for improvement.
- Model Refinement: Use machine learning techniques to automatically refine the predictive model based on new project outcomes.
- Trend Analysis: Utilize AI to identify long-term trends in project timelines across multiple IT projects.
This workflow can be significantly enhanced with the integration of various AI-driven tools:
- Forecast: This AI-powered platform can improve resource allocation and provide accurate timeline predictions based on historical data and current project parameters.
- Celoxis: Offers predictive analytics capabilities to estimate project duration and potential bottlenecks, allowing for real-time adjustments to the timeline forecast.
- IBM Watson: Can be utilized for risk identification and assessment, analyzing project documentation to highlight potential timeline impacts.
- DataRobot: Automates the data preparation and model selection process, streamlining the development of predictive models for timeline forecasting.
- Sensei IQ: Provides autonomous project tracking, which can be integrated into the continuous monitoring phase to flag issues that may affect the timeline.
- GPT-4: When integrated with project management platforms, it can support real-time decision-making by analyzing extensive project data and providing insights for timeline adjustments.
By integrating these AI-driven tools, the workflow becomes more dynamic and responsive to changes. The AI systems can continuously learn from new data, enhancing the accuracy of timeline predictions over time. They can also automate many repetitive tasks in project management, allowing human project managers to focus on strategic decision-making and stakeholder management.
This AI-enhanced workflow for predictive analytics in IT project timeline forecasting can lead to more accurate predictions, improved resource allocation, proactive risk management, and ultimately, more successful project outcomes in the Information Technology industry.
Keyword: AI predictive analytics for IT projects
